Description du poste

Our financial services client is seeking a Senior Cyber Security IAM Specialist (10+ years) to design and deliver identity and access management capabilities

Join a confidential engagement supporting secure identity and access management initiatives within a national financial institution. This role leads the definition, documentation, and implementation of IAM processes, including privileged access, authentication, and cryptographic control improvements. The consultant contributes to high-impact security modernization efforts with visibility across cyber, architecture, and operations teams. This is a long-term contract supported under a protected and exclusive RFC process.

Responsabilités

  • Gather and analyze technical and non-technical requirements for IAM capabilities and control improvements
  • Define and document current-state and future-state IAM processes, dependencies, and control points
  • Design IAM use cases and support implementation to strengthen authentication and secrets management
  • Support development of control effectiveness metrics, traceability artifacts, and roadmap reporting inputs
  • Create end-user documentation, procedural guidance, and training materials for IAM adoption
  • Provide guidance to Cyber, IT, architecture, operations, and business teams on IAM objectives
  • Support planning for cryptographic inventory, algorithm transition, certificate impacts, and PQC readiness
  • Facilitate workshops and translate stakeholder needs into actionable requirements and user stories

Exigences

  • Minimum 5 years in Cyber Security and information technology focusing on identity and access management (IAM)
  • Expertise in privileged access management,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A), Public Key Infrastructure (PKI), and cryptographic controls
  • Experience translating risk, compliance, and architectural requirements into functional and non-functional specifications
  • Recent applied knowledge of post-quantum cryptography (PQC), algorithm transition planning, and enterprise crypto-agility concepts
  • University degree or college diploma in computer science, information security, risk management, or related field

Atouts

  • Demonstrated experience working with tools such as Sailpoint or CyberArk
  • Knowledge of cloud-based access controls including Conditional Access, SAML, and OATH/OIDC authentication
  • Understanding of Zero Trust principles and implementation patterns
  • Proficiency in business intelligence and reporting for control measurement and decision support
  • Experience using automation to streamline repetitive tasks and data analysis
